Modern English
history
Modern English is an English rock band formed in 1980 in Colchester, Essex. They were initially part of the post-punk movement and gained fame in the early 1980s with their hit single 'I Melt with You'. The band's lineup consisted of Robbie Grey (vocals), Michael Conroy (bass), Gary McDowell (guitar), and Richard Brown (drums). Their debut album, 'Mesh & Lace', was released in 1981, showcasing a sound characterized by jangly guitars and atmospheric synths. The band's 1982 album, 'After the Snow', produced 'I Melt with You', which became an anthem of the era and solidified their place in the new wave genre. After a hiatus in the late 1980s, Modern English reunited in the 1990s and continued to tour and release new music, embracing their legacy while evolving their sound. They have maintained a loyal fan base and remain influential in the alternative rock scene.
